3DViaPlayerActiveX.ocx is a software component that allows users to view 3D models in web browsers. It is commonly used for interactive product demonstrations and visualizations on websites. This ActiveX control enables enhanced user experience by providing interactive 3D content within a web page.

Understanding Common Issues with Ocx Files
An OCX file is a component or control file used by ActiveX forms in Microsoft programs. These files are helpful, but users may experience several issues when dealing with OCX files. Here are some common ones:
- Issues Stemming from Multiple OCX Files: If a system hosts multiple versions of the same OCX file, it can trigger conflicts that result in errors or a lack of stability in the applications that leverage the file.
- Damaged Files: If an OCX file is compromised due to factors like an unfinished download, disk errors, or malware, it could cause difficulties when an application seeks to use it.
- Discrepancies Due to Missing OCX Files: When an OCX file is not present at its specified location, it can cause applications that rely on it to malfunction or produce errors. This typically occurs when the file has been inadvertently deleted or moved.
- Compatibility Concerns: If an OCX file is tailored for a particular version of an application or Windows, it might not work as intended with different versions. This could lead to functional problems or a complete inability of the component to load.
- Difficulty Opening OCX Files: Users might face difficulties opening OCX files if the file associations are incorrect, or if the user is trying to open the file in an incompatible program.
